Be Wiser Kawasaki to branch out to F1 sidecars

1 of 1

New MCE British Superbike team Be Wiser Kawasaki, managed by former BSB champion Tommy Hill, is set to expand for its debut season even before launching new bikes, with a merger with top British F1 sidecar duo Ricky Stevens and Ryan Charlwood.

The move will see Stevens and Charlwood’s Team WPS/Assured Office Solutions Kawasaki outfit fall under the Be Wiser Kawasaki branding, as the insurance company spreads its sponsorship to the three wheeled community.

Team boss Tommy Hill commented: “We’ve decided to take the lead in having an alliance between two completely different championships and types of machinery. I’ve seen the Sidecar paddock grow in stature and professionalism over the years, and it really caught my eye last year.”

“I was left wondering why there’s no connection between the Superbike class and the Sidecar Championship. With AOS (Assured Office Solutions) agreeing to be a team partner for 2015, this allows us to join forces with the WPS AOS Sidecar race team, which is great news, and also gives another spectacle for our team partners too.”

Roger Body, organiser of the British F1 championship, added: “We have been working towards this type of merger for many seasons now. This association will further enforce the value to BSB teams of having a wider presence both in the paddock and on-track. I cannot overstate the advantages.”

Hill’s new superbike machines, designed by himself in his other life as a graphic designer, will be unveiled at Motorcycle Live at the NEC on Monday, at 11am on the main stage.
